What Are These Platforms?

HoneyBook

HoneyBook is a comprehensive business management platform designed for creative entrepreneurs and service-based businesses. It combines:

  • Client relationship management (CRM)
  • Contract and proposal creation
  • Invoicing and payment processing
  • Scheduling and automations
  • Client portals and messaging

HoneyBook is ideal for photographers, planners, coaches, and consultants who want everything in one place—from lead capture to final invoice.

Bonsai

Bonsai (formerly AND.CO) is an all-in-one freelance business platform that includes:

  • Contract templates and e-signatures
  • Invoicing and payment processing
  • Time tracking and expense management
  • Tax preparation tools
  • Client portal and file sharing
  • CRM and project management

Bonsai is ideal for freelancers who want comprehensive business management, especially those who need time tracking and tax features.

YesFlow

YesFlow is a secure file delivery and payment platform built specifically for creative freelancers who need to protect their work until they get paid. It focuses on solving one problem really well: getting client approval and payment without the back-and-forth chaos.

YesFlow is ideal for designers, developers, writers, and video editors who need watermark protection, instant client access, and zero platform fees.

Pricing Breakdown: The Hidden Costs

Let's say you're a designer who invoices $10,000/month in client work.

HoneyBook

Monthly: $39/mo

Platform fees (2.5%): $250/mo

Stripe (2.9% + 30¢): $290/mo


Total: $6,948/year

Bonsai

Monthly: $25/mo

Platform fees (2.9%): $290/mo

Stripe (2.9% + 30¢): $290/mo


Total: $7,260/year

YesFlow

Monthly: $29/mo

Platform fees: $0

Stripe (2.9% + 30¢): $290/mo


Total: $3,828/year

Payment Protection: YesFlow's Biggest Advantage

HoneyBook & Bonsai let you send invoices and collect payments, but once you email final files (or share them via Dropbox/Google Drive), the client has them. There's no built-in protection to prevent them from ghosting after downloading your work.

YesFlow automatically watermarks all preview files and blocks downloads until payment clears. Clients can review, request revisions, and approve your work—but they can't access the final, clean files without paying first.

This is a game-changer for freelancers who've been burned before.

Client Experience: Simplicity Wins

HoneyBook & Bonsai require clients to create accounts if they want to access project portals, messaging, or file sharing beyond basic invoice payments.

YesFlow sends clients a single link. They click, review, pay, and download. No signup. No password. No friction.

For client-facing simplicity, YesFlow wins.

Business Management: HoneyBook & Bonsai's Strength

If you need to automate multi-step client onboarding sequences, manage contracts, track time, or handle taxes, HoneyBook and Bonsai excel here.

HoneyBook is particularly strong for client-facing businesses (photographers, event planners) with its automation workflows and proposal templates.

Bonsai adds time tracking, expense management, and tax preparation tools that make it appealing for hourly consultants and freelancers who need those features.

YesFlow doesn't compete in this space. It's focused purely on the delivery-to-payment moment, not the full client lifecycle.
